Ludhiana: Today is ‘World Environment Day’ and it holds much greater significance in today’s times when there is pandemic around. With rise of industrial pollution, increasing number of vehicles on roads, deforestation, cutting of tress and other factors have contributed significantly in environmental degradation. It has really played havoc with the healthy life of individuals.
There are many doctors and staff in DMCH, who contribute a lot in their capacity to enhance environment around.   

Dr Monika Singla, Associate Professor of Neurology, says that though she has all along been environment friendly but ever since pandemic has struck the country, she has become much more focused in growing plants inside home and outdoor also. This activity creates a lot of happiness and satisfaction, when there is nothing much to do in otherwise normal routine, says Dr Monika Singla

 

Another employee Ms Nisha Chandel (in Billing Department of DMCH), an avid gardener, has grown many plants and flowers to beautify her surroundings and also encourage her friends and colleagues to find time for this environment- friendly activity. An interest in gardening and working with plants is a way for better interest of the community—and save the earth. Her other close friends have also started taking keen interest in improving the environment and make life better for everyone, ever since the city is kept under lockdown.
